adidas Soccer – adizero f50 Powered by miCoach
This new :30 commercial from adidas stars Messi and highlights the new adizero F50, which at 5.8 ounces is the lightest cleat in the game. Hitting stores 12/1, the new F50 is compatible with miCoach SPEED_CELL, allowing players to track, upload and share data from their on-field performance including speed, time and distance.

Jaguares Has New Social Media Objective
Mexican team Jaguares has taken social media to a new level. In an effort that seems focused on getting fans more engaged with the players (and their beer sponsor), Jaguares have replaced the players names on the back of the jerseys to the players Twitter handles.
